Australian Plant Name Index (APNI)
The Australian Plant Name Index (APNI) is a tool for the botanical community that deals with plant names and their usage in the scientific literature, whether as a current name or synonym. APNI does not recommend any particular taxonomy or nomenclature. Comment:Chappill et al. include "Gompholobium polymorphum Sieb. ex Benth." in synonymy, listing it as a nomen nudum in G.Bentham, Fl. Austral. 2: 48 (1864). However, this appears to be a misinterpretation of Bentham's reporting that the name G. polymorphum R.Br. had been misapplied to G. glabratum by Sieber in exsiccatae.
